#0c1966 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c1966 is composed of 4.7% red, 9.8%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 231.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 22.4%. #0c1966 color hex could be obtained by blending #1832c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#0c1966 color description : Very dark blue.
#0c1966 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c1966 has RGB values of R:12, G:25,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 792934.
